ALS support group to meet
      A free support group for people with ALS, their families and friends will meet from 1 to 2:30 p.m. Sat., March 24 at the city of Westlake Village community room, 31200 Oak Crest Drive. The meeting is conducted by the ALS Association, Greater Los Angeles Chapter.

Garden of Hope fundraiser
      The Centennial Guild of Childrens Hospital Los Angeles will present a Garden of Hope Fashion Show and Luncheon at 10 a.m. Fri., March 9 at the Four Seasons Hotel, Two Dole Drive, Westlake Village. A boutique will feature more than 30 vendors from all over Southern California.
